KC Water, which serves some 170,000 customers, said late on Friday that it had failed to meet “enhanced treatment technique standards” this month for the treatment of the parasite Cryptosporidium, which can cause diarrhea. Record floodwaters that submerged vast stretches of Nebraska and Iowa farmland along the Missouri River crested on Friday at the waterfront city of St. Joseph, Missouri, forcing the evacuation of thousands of residents from low-lying areas.
